Peter Kokot d679f02295 Sync leading and final newlines in *.phpt sections
This patch adds missing newlines, trims multiple redundant final
newlines into a single one, and trims redundant leading newlines in all
*.phpt sections.

According to POSIX, a line is a sequence of zero or more non-' <newline>'
characters plus a terminating '<newline>' character. [1] Files should
normally have at least one final newline character.

C89 [2] and later standards [3] mention a final newline:
"A source file that is not empty shall end in a new-line character,
which shall not be immediately preceded by a backslash character."

Although it is not mandatory for all files to have a final newline
fixed, a more consistent and homogeneous approach brings less of commit
differences issues and a better development experience in certain text
editors and IDEs.

--TEST--
Test gzopen() function : variation: use include path (relative directories in path)
--SKIPIF--
<?php
if (!extension_loaded("zlib")) {
print "skip - ZLIB extension not loaded";
}
?>
--FILE--
<?php
/* Prototype : resource gzopen(string filename, string mode [, int use_include_path])
* Description: Open a .gz-file and return a .gz-file pointer
* Source code: ext/zlib/zlib.c
* Alias to functions:
*/
echo "*** Testing gzopen() : usage variation ***\n";
require_once('reading_include_path.inc');
//define the files to go into these directories, create one in dir2
echo "\n--- testing include path ---\n";
set_include_path($newIncludePath);
$modes = array("r", "r+", "rt");
foreach($modes as $mode) {
test_gzopen($mode);
}
restore_include_path();
// remove the directory structure
chdir($baseDir);
rmdir($workingDir);
foreach($newdirs as $newdir) {
rmdir($newdir);
}
chdir("..");
rmdir($thisTestDir);
function test_gzopen($mode) {
global $scriptFile, $secondFile, $firstFile, $filename;
// create a file in the middle directory
$h = gzopen($secondFile, "w");
gzwrite($h, "This is a file in dir2");
gzclose($h);
echo "\n** testing with mode=$mode **\n";
// should read dir2 file
$h = gzopen($filename, $mode, true);
gzpassthru($h);
gzclose($h);
echo "\n";
//create a file in dir1
$h = gzopen($firstFile, "w");
gzwrite($h, "This is a file in dir1");
gzclose($h);
//should now read dir1 file
$h = gzopen($filename, $mode, true);
gzpassthru($h);
gzclose($h);
echo "\n";
// create a file in working directory
$h = gzopen($filename, "w");
gzwrite($h, "This is a file in working dir");
gzclose($h);
//should still read dir1 file
$h = gzopen($filename, $mode, true);
gzpassthru($h);
gzclose($h);
echo "\n";
unlink($firstFile);
unlink($secondFile);
//should read the file in working dir
$h = gzopen($filename, $mode, true);
gzpassthru($h);
gzclose($h);
echo "\n";
// create a file in the script directory
$h = gzopen($scriptFile, "w");
gzwrite($h, "This is a file in script dir");
gzclose($h);
//should read the file in script dir
$h = gzopen($filename, $mode, true);
gzpassthru($h);
gzclose($h);
echo "\n";
//cleanup
unlink($filename);
unlink($scriptFile);
}
?>
===DONE===
